- Carbon Upcycling — Carbon Upcycling Technologies (“CUT”) was formed to use the pollution of today to build the materials of tomorrow by converting CO2 gas into solid products. CUT sells advanced solid products derived from greenhouse emissions and cheaply available solids. Since 2014, CUT has scaled its ability to convert CO2 emissions into value-add end materials byover a million times. Through its portfolio of CO2-derived solid nanoparticles, CUT has technically validated its solutions for use in plastics, coatings, epoxy, adhesives, concrete, lithium-ion battery, and pharmaceutical industries. CUT recently launched a consumer brand called Expedition Air.CUT commercialized a corrosion-resistant coating, utilizing its nanoparticles, in 2017, becoming the youngest CO2 utilization company to generate commercial revenue (<2.5 years since inception) and has since been confirmed as one of the top CO2 utilization companies in the world as a winner of the X-Factor Award in the NRG COSIA Carbon XPRIZE. CUT has been named as a Solar Impulse Efficient Solution label recipient, a funding recipient of Fundación Repsol Entrepreneurs Fund, and a winner of the 2019 76West Clean Technology Competition.CUT’s most advanced product is its CO2-embedded concrete additive. In 2018, CUT graduated from the LafargeHolcim Accelerator in France and has continued conversations and testing with the company since then. CUT is also partnered with Burnco and Cemex. CUT’s commercial demonstration at the Alberta Carbon Conversion Technology Centre produces over 20 tonnes of concrete additives in a day. The product reduces the carbon footprint of concrete manufacturing by up to 25% while increasing the compressive strength of concrete by up to 40%.

MaRS Innovation (MI) is a commercialization engine that integrates, centralizes and accelerates time to market of the discovery and intellectual property assets from its 15 world-class research institutions. MI’s discovery and innovation pipeline is derived from $1 billion in annual R&D funding. Created as a not-for-profit organizationthrough the Government of Canada’s Center of Excellence for Commercialization and Research program (CECR), MI has raised $50 million from federal and provincial governments, member institutions and industry partners. MI’s vision is to transform the Toronto-based research enterprise into one of world’s most successful commercialization clusters.Through detailed, market facing due diligence, MI identifies opportunities from Canada’s largest academic cluster for further development and commercialization through project management, intellectual property management, investment and technology development. By crossing the innovation gap, MI transforms these opportunities into successful high-value licensing transactions and financeable start-up companies.
